States Told to Finalize Drafting of Labour Codes by March 31
Hindustan Times Lucknow
|January 30, 2025
Union Labour Minister Mansukh Mandaviya met his counterparts from all 36 states and federally-administered territories at a two-day conference beginning January 29 to "exchange notes and review" the final set of steps in the framing of draft rules to roll out the four labour codes, along with other reforms to boost employment, an official aware of the matter said on Wednesday.
NEW DELHI:
The ministry, in a release, said all states are slated to complete the draft rules by March 31. This will pave the way for a roll-out of the codes in the early part of the next financial year, which HT had reported on January 21.
